Key Differences
In short — Radeon RX 560 XT outperforms GeForce GTX 750 on the selected game parameters. We do not have the prices of both CPUs to compare value. The better performing Radeon RX 560 XT is 1849 days newer than GeForce GTX 750.
Advantages of NVIDIA GeForce GTX 750
- Consumes up to 63% less energy than AMD Radeon RX 560 XT - 55 vs 150 Watts
Advantages of AMD Radeon RX 560 XT
- Performs up to 31% better in Battlefield V than GeForce GTX 750 - 111 vs 85 FPS
- Up to 300% more VRAM memory than NVIDIA GeForce GTX 750 - 4 vs 1 GB

NVIDIA GeForce GTX 750 | vs | AMD Radeon RX 560 XT |
---|---|---|
Feb 18th, 2014 | Release Date | Mar 13th, 2019 |
GeForce 700 | Generation | Polaris |
$119 | MSRP | Not Available |
2x DVI, 1x mini-HDMI | Outputs | 1x HDMI, 3x DisplayPort |
None | Power Connectors | 1x 6-pin |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
1 GB | Memory | 4 GB |
GDDR5 | Type | GDDR5 |
128-bit | Bus | 256-bit |
80.19 GB/s | Bandwidth | 224 GB/s |
1020 MHz | Base Clock Speed | 1074 MHz |
1085 MHz | Boost Clock Speed | 1226 MHz |
1253 MHz | Memory Clock Speed | 1750 MHz |
